Be Transparent About Damage
Full disclosure is not just smart—it’s required by law. One of our top tips to sell a damaged home in Las Vegas, NV is to be honest and upfront about known issues. Whether it’s a leaky roof, fire damage, or a cracked foundation, disclosing problems builds trust and protects you from legal consequences later.

Make Minor Cosmetic Fixes
While major repairs might be out of the question, small cosmetic improvements can still go a long way. Simple fixes like patching drywall, painting, or cleaning up the yard can improve the look and feel of your home, even if deeper damage exists beneath the surface.

Know Who to Target
Marketing a damaged property is different from selling a typical home. Instead of traditional buyers using bank financing, your target audience should be investors, flippers, or cash buyers—people who see the value in distressed real estate.

Understand Your Options
Before rushing into renovations or accepting the first offer that comes your way, take the time to explore all your selling options. In some cases, fixing the home and listing it may offer higher returns—but only if you have the budget, time, and emotional bandwidth to manage the process.
